Mozambique’s Ministry of Sea, Inland Waters and Fisheries has launched Africa's largest mangrove reforestation project.
UAE-based mangrove reforestation specialist, Blue Forest, is a partner.
Over the next 30 years, between 50 million to 100 million trees will be planted in the "biodiversity-sensitive" provinces of Sofala and Zambezia across 185,000 hectares of mangrove forests, according to a statement. It is estimated that approximately 200,000 tonnes of CO2 emissions will be offset annually in the long term, equivalent to taking 50,000 cars off the road.
